Blood culture testing remains the gold standard – but it’s increasingly under pressure
Accurate and timely blood cultures help guide effective sepsis management. Yet rising demand, antimicrobial resistance, staffing shortages, and workflow complexity are placing unprecedented pressure on clinical microbiology labs.

First-of-its-kind gravimetric individual blood volume measurement (iBVM) for every BD BACTEC™ Culture vial.* Automated gravimetric individual blood volume measurement can accurately report blood volume for every vial.6 Blood volume monitoring analytics, evaluating if vials are over-or under-filled are reported via the dynamic intelligence of BD Synapsys™ Informatics.

Born from our legacy, driven by our vision.
For more than 50 years, we have set the standard in blood culture innovation – from the first automated blood culture instrument to resin technology, lytic anaerobic media, blood-volume monitoring, and satellite culturing.
